首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

cmd登录不了mysql数据库

cmd登录不了MySQL数据库可能有以下几种原因和解决方法:

  1. 输入的用户名或密码错误:确保在cmd中正确输入了MySQL数据库的用户名和密码,用户名和密码区分大小写。如果忘记了密码,可以通过重置密码的方式重新设置密码。
  2. MySQL服务未启动:在cmd中登录MySQL数据库之前,确保MySQL服务已经启动。可以通过在cmd中执行以下命令来启动MySQL服务:
  3. MySQL服务未启动:在cmd中登录MySQL数据库之前,确保MySQL服务已经启动。可以通过在cmd中执行以下命令来启动MySQL服务:
  4. MySQL端口被占用:如果MySQL数据库使用的默认端口(通常为3306)被其他程序占用,可能会导致登录失败。可以通过修改MySQL配置文件中的端口号来解决冲突。
  5. 防火墙或安全组限制:防火墙或安全组设置可能会限制cmd登录MySQL数据库。确保已经配置了正确的入站规则,允许cmd访问MySQL数据库所在的服务器端口。
  6. MySQL数据库权限限制:如果MySQL数据库的权限设置不正确,可能会导致无法通过cmd登录。可以通过在MySQL中授予对应用户正确的权限来解决该问题。

如果以上方法仍然无法解决问题,建议检查MySQL数据库的日志文件以获取更详细的错误信息,并根据错误信息进行进一步的排查和修复。

关于MySQL数据库的更多信息和解决方案,您可以参考腾讯云的云数据库MySQL产品(https://cloud.tencent.com/product/cdb_mysql)和MySQL相关文档(https://cloud.tencent.com/document/product/236)。

请注意,本回答中未提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,仅给出了答案内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L可以正常用,但cmd启动不了mysql,报错 unknown variable ;basedir=....问题

SQL可以正常用,但cmd启动不了mysql,报错[ERROR] unknown variable ;basedir=….问题 解决办法:将对应[mysql]下面的内容全部转移到【mysqld...】下面,我这里是[mysqld]在[mysql]下面 内容很多: 其移动内容较多,比如说下面 比如#skip-grant-tables # 设置mysql的安装目录 basedir=E:\MY_SQL..._5.7\mysql-5.7.17-winx64 # 设置mysql数据库的数据的存放目录 datadir=E:\MY_SQL_5.7\mysql-5.7.17-winx64\data # 允许最大连接数...上网查了下解决办法,参照步骤如下解决: 编辑mysql配置文件my.ini(不知道在哪请搜索),在[mysqld]这个条目下加入 skip-grant-tables 保存退出后重启mysql...改好之后,再修改一下my.ini这个文件,把刚才加入的”skip-grant-tables”这行删除,保存退出再重启mysql

4.1K60

SQL可以正常用,但cmd启动不了mysql,报错 unknown variable ;basedir=....问题

SQL可以正常用,但cmd启动不了mysql,报错[ERROR] unknown variable ;basedir=….问题 解决办法:将对应[mysql]下面的内容全部转移到【mysqld】下面...,我这里是[mysqld]在[mysql]下面 内容很多: 其移动内容较多,比如说下面 比如#skip-grant-tables # 设置mysql的安装目录 basedir=E:\MY_SQL..._5.7\mysql-5.7.17-winx64 # 设置mysql数据库的数据的存放目录 datadir=E:\MY_SQL_5.7\mysql-5.7.17-winx64\data # 允许最大连接数...上网查了下解决办法,参照步骤如下解决: 编辑mysql配置文件my.ini(不知道在哪请搜索),在[mysqld]这个条目下加入 skip-grant-tables 保存退出后重启mysql...改好之后,再修改一下my.ini这个文件,把刚才加入的”skip-grant-tables”这行删除,保存退出再重启mysql

2.1K50

登录mysql数据库的几种方式

登录mysql数据库的几种方式 第1种 (通过mysql自带的客户端,MySQL 5.5 Command Line Client) 不推荐这种方式 注意:这种登录方式,只适用于root用户,不够灵活...(只适合于root用户登录,只限于root用户,以后我们可能还有很多其他的用户,那其他用户就无法用这种方式登录了,所以这种方式登录mysql数据库有局限性),所以不推荐使用这种方式登录mysql数据库...退出登录,可以使用exit命令或者是ctrl + c 如下图: 第2种 (使用windows的dos命令窗口,使用mysql命令)推荐这种方式,如下截图: win键 + r 再输入cmd 如下图:在...-h192.168.117.66 -P3306 -uroot -proot就ok了,如下图: 退出登录,可以使用exit命令 注意:mysql这个关键字是mysql数据库中的命令,而不是windows...我们要退出mysql数据库登录,怎么退出呢?

6.1K20

linux上安装使用mysql(linux登录mysql数据库)

首先明确大体步骤为3步 1.下载数据库的压缩包或二进制包,可以在linux用wget或yum下载,也可以外网下载再传到linux 2.配置数据库的环境和路径 3.登陆数据库修改 一....#chown -R mysql.mysql /usr/local/mysqlmysql目录下创建data文件夹 #mkdir data 初始化数据库 #/usr/local/mysql/bin/...=/usr/local/mysql/data –initialize 如果还是报错可以执行下面命令,然后再执行上面数据库初始化的命令 #yum -y install numactl #yum search...-uroot -p 使用第二个命令是没有配置环境变量 #export PATH=$PATH:/usr/local/mysql/bin 上图为登录成功,再操作数据库设置密码 #use mysql; #...#set password=password(“root”); #flush privileges; #exit 将 /etc/my.cnf 中skip-grant-tables删除或注释掉 如果操作不了数据库可以再次修改下密码

10.3K10

mysql——cmd进入mysql及常用的mysql操作

cmd进入mysql操作 win+R,输入cmd,打开cmd窗口,进入到 mysql bin目录的路径下 第一步:启动mysql服务,可以通过“net start myql”命令实现; 第二步:先使用DOS...命令进入mysql的安装目录下的bin目录中; 第三步:在命令行输入:mysql -u 用户名 -p密码;回车;-h表示服务器名,localhost表示本地,-hlocalhost 可不输入;-u为数据库用户名...显示结果: cmd下的mysql操作 数据库有关操作 1.查询时间:select now(); 2.查询当前用户:select user(); 3.查询数据库版本:select version();...4.列出数据库:show databases; 5.选择数据库:use databaseName; 6.建立数据库:create database databaseName; 7.查看新创建的数据库信息...所以要以管理员身份来运行cmd程序来启动mysql。 dos命令的基本操作: 盘符: 例如想进入D盘 d: cd 进入到当前盘某个目录。

8.2K10

mysql卸载重装教程_MySQL安装不了

项目场景: 最近接到了新项目开发,数据库用到了MySQL,借着这个机会重新整理下文件,也再进一步熟悉下MySQL; 卸载MySQL 1、停止MySQl服务 (1) 任务管理器>服务>找到对应的mysql...文件夹删除 3.删除MySQL程序 4.删除MySQL物理文件 对应的安装路径删除,以及删除隐藏的ProgramData文件里的MySQL文件 安装MySQL 1、下载MySQL Windows...---------mysql软件路径------------- basedir=D:\\softs\\MySQL\\mysql # 设置mysql数据库的数据的存放目录 ---------对应的data...\System32 目录下的 cmd.exe,以管理员身份运行 (2) 找到 MySql对应的bin 文件路径 并 执行 mysqld –initialize –console 命令 mysqld -...; 提示 Query OK, 就修改成功了 使用Navicat 测试MySQL数据库连接 这样便完成了MySQL的卸载和安装,主要是文件的配置,要细心细心细心,最后小伙伴们既然看到这儿了,你的点赞和评论是对笔者最大的动力和肯定

2.5K30
领券